I am walking so much better now!!! I am now working with Nat at Riverview for my PT and what a difference!! I am walking with my feet close together and really shifting all of my weight over on my prosthetic side when I take a step with my left foot. I can't wait for Jerald and Dr. Fox to see my progress. New mechinism
I got a new mechinism for my leg a couple of days ago. No more bolt/pin on the end of my stump/residual limb. It will always be a stump to me but they like the politically corrrect term. It is so much more comfortable.

Stop Thinking!!!!!
I met with Dr. Fox, my prosthesist - Jerald Cunningham, and my physical therapist - Shelly Coule this week and they all want me to walk without thinking! In fact they are insistent on it!!! They don't care what my real (right) foot is doing and they don't want me to think about walking at all. "Just walk"
They argue that I am thinking way too much and in doing so, I am making walking much harder, much more difficult than it needs to be. In fact they say just do it. I know it sounds like an old Nike commericial but I think that I have finally got it through my thick cranium. I guess then it should be easy or at least much easier than I have made it.
